C. BRIEFINGS TO CITY COUNCIL:
1. New Residential Street Construction
Mayor Pro Tem Lucy Rubio referred to Item 1.City Manager Margie C.Rose
provided opening remarks regarding New Residential Street Construction and
introduced Assistant City Manager Keith Selman who provided background
information and a summary of topics to be discussed.
Interim Director of Development Services Julio Dimas presented information
on the following topics: typical development process;detailed development
process,including the typical and deferred process and timeframes of each;
and a description of unit phasing.

Director of Engineering Services Jeff Edmonds presented information on the
following topics: street design standards;residential street design standards;
minimum residential street design standards for asphalt and concrete;and
typical maintenance lifecycle for asphalt and concrete.
Council members and staff discussed the structural strength of a limestone
versus caliche base on developer-constructed streets.
Council members and staff discussed street standards applied on different city
bond programs.
Council members and staff went on to discuss the following topics related to
developer-constructed streets: street standards applicable to phased
developments;that the street construction standard approved in a preliminary
platting permit continues in effect during the term of the permit and any
extension(s)thereof;the process whereby the Planning Commission grants
extensions of preliminary platting permits;requiring a new preliminary plat
upon expiration of a preliminary platting permit;the standard width of two-way
streets;whether developers are still building streets with a caliche base as an
approved standard;an explanation of"vested rights";the number of permit
extensions granted by the Planning Commission;the duration of a preliminary
platting permit;and clarifying,in the Unified Development Code(UDC),the
number of preliminary plat permit extensions that can be granted.
MOTION OF DIRECTION
Council Member Smith made a motion directing the City Manager to examine
the UDC regarding platting extensions,seconded by Council Member Vaughn.
Council Members and staff discussed the following additional topics related to
developer-constructed streets: the extension of a preliminary platting permit
being granted subject to street construction standards current at the time an
extension is granted;and legal considerations regarding changing street
construction standards upon extension of a plat.
The motion directing the City Manager to examine the UDC regarding platting
was approved unanimously.
Council members and staff discussed the following additional topics relating
to developer-constructed streets: when soil sampling is conducted in the
street design/construction process;how street construction standards are
verified once streets are built;and the city maintaining street
construction-related data.
Council members and staff discussed whether a geo-grid or additional depth
of limestone base is required/used on city bond projects.
Assistant City Manager Keith Selman presented the following additional
information: the pros and cons of concrete versus asphalt;and new
residential street development issues.
Council members and staff discussed the following topics: digging up new
streets when utility repairs have to be made; not locating utilities under
streets;maintenance of concrete versus asphalt streets;and evaluating the
value of concrete versus asphalt when considering street construction bids.

Mayor Pro Tem Rubio called for comments from the public. Chuck Urban,
Urban Engineering,provided a history of developments in which developers
constructed streets using concrete,the cost of using concrete versus asphalt
in developer-constructed streets,and the effect weather and rainfall have on
streets. Fred Braselton,Braselton Homes,spoke regarding concerns about
the cost of developer-constructed streets that are a part of developers'overall
costs of a development;reasons for phased subdivisions,the time needed to
build out subdivisions,and platting permit extensions.
Council members and staff discussed the following additional topics:
location-specific design standards for street construction location;the Street
Department's capacity to maintain existing concrete streets;developing a
concrete street maintenance plan;that the City currently contracts out
replacement of concrete street panels;status of progress on the Street
Preventive Maintenance Program(SPMP);and extending the warranty period
and/or requiring bonding from developers relating to developer-constructed
streets.
MOTION OF DIRECTION
Council Member Rubio made a motion directing the City Manager to extend the
warranty period for public improvements from one year to two years,seconded
by Council Member Guajardo and passed unanimously(Council Member
Vaughn-absent).
